The Benefits of a Mesothelioma Legal Action

A successful lawsuit can help victims and their families have a financially secure future. It could also hold asbestos firms accountable for placing profit ahead of safety.

The typical lawsuit begins by filing a complaint in a court. The complaint details the victim's exposure as well as the reason why they are entitled to compensation. Defendant companies have 30 days to reply. Nearly all mesothelioma lawsuits are settled, rather than going to court.

Compensation

The purpose of mesothelioma compensation is to assist victims and their families gain financial stability, cover their medical expenses and provide for themselves in the future. It also serves as justice by holding asbestos companies that are negligent accountable for their actions.

The kinds of settlements for mesothelioma victims can differ, but on average, the amount awarded is $1,000,000. Compensation can be based on monetary damages, for example, pain and suffering, funeral expenses, and other losses.

Compensation may also be derived from private insurance as well as government programs such as veterans benefits and trust funds. A mesothelioma attorney can determine which sources are most beneficial to their client. They can also file claims for asbestos victims in the courts that are most open to their claims. Factors such as a court's asbestos litigation history and the state's statutes of limitations can impact this decision.

Patients suffering from mesothelioma who are covered by Medicare or other health insurance plans can apply for additional benefits. Medicare patients with mesothelioma could be eligible for additional coverage under the Comprehensive Care for Asbestos Patients program (CCAP). Eligible mesothelioma patients can also seek compensation through Social Security Disability Insurance (SSDI). This type of financial aid is only accessible to those who meet the criteria for working eligibility and pay Social Security taxes.

Mesothelioma victims' families who have passed away may also bring lawsuits for wrongful death. The survivors of a victim who died can receive compensation for funeral and burial expenses, loss of companionship, financial support and other losses.

The majority of mesothelioma lawsuits are settled outside of court, which allows victims and their families to receive their compensation quicker. If there is no settlement mesothelioma lawyers can bring the case to trial.

Medical expenses

Medical expenses are a major concern for mesothelioma patients as well as their families. Compensation can be used to pay the costs of treatment, assist with lost income due illness and to pay for necessities of the family such as childcare. Compensation can also help alleviate the emotional stress that comes with financial issues.

Compensation is available through various sources, including settlements for personal injury, or lawsuits for wrongful deaths as well as asbestos trust funds. Each mesothelioma case is unique and the amount of compensation differ based on the severity of symptoms, type of cancer and treatment plan. Mesothelioma lawyers analyze all aspects of the victim's situation to maximize the amount of compensation.

The families of victims and the victims must keep careful records of all mesothelioma-related expenses to be prepared for legal cases. The more documentation available, the better chances of a successful mesothelioma settlement or verdict. These records are also useful to attorneys during settlement negotiations.

Mesothelioma is a rare and aggressive cancer that requires expensive treatment. These costs can quickly increase especially if a patient has to travel for their treatment. Compensation can be used to cover the cost of accommodation and travel for mesothelioma sufferers and their families.
